154201 is an odd composite number. It is composed of two dist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four divisors.

Prime factorization of 154201:

41 × 3761

Factors of 154201

  • Number of distinct prime factors ω(n): 2
  • Total number of prime factors Ω(n): 2
  • Sum of prime factors: 3802

Divisors of 154201

  • Number of divisors d(n): 4
  • Complete list of divisors:
  • Sum of all divisors σ(n): 158004
  • Sum of proper divisors (its aliquot sum) s(n): 3803
  • 154201 is a deficient number, because the sum of its proper divisors (3803) is less than itself. Its deficiency is 150398
